Abstract
[GRAPHICS] We have investigated the use of chiral silylating reagents as analytical pr obes for determining the absolute stereochemistry of natural products by NM R spectroscopy. These reagents are prepared in high chemical yield in one s tep and can be used to derivatize chiral allylic alcohols which are incompa tible with ester-based methodologies, Microscale (similar to 400 nmol) deri vatization conditions have been defined. The resulting siloxane diastereome rs are readily distinguished by their H-1 NMR spectra.
